Looker Studio offers seamless integration with Google products, supporting business visualization and collaboration through efficient data management and analytics, catering to teams aiming for quick analytics solutions.
Looker Studio combines diverse data source integration including SQL and MongoDB with powerful visualization and custom filter creation. Users find its visuals clean and its platform user-friendly, enhanced by collaboration features and pricing. It aids decision-making and is popular for tracking metrics and analyzing sales funnels. Despite its strengths, users seek faster report loading, simpler data modeling, and better interface usability. Advertising system limitations, delayed data reflections, and integration challenges affect performance. Security and stability improvements alongside a richer data modeling layer are desirable, with pricing impacting large organizations.
What are the most important features of Looker Studio?Looker Studio supports business visualization for different industries, creating dashboards and reports for sales and marketing analysis. It's used to track metrics and sales funnels from sources like Google Sheets and BigQuery. Many companies integrate Looker Studio within web apps, providing data insights tailored to sectors such as e-commerce, finance, and more.
MicroStrategy is known for its scalability and stability. It supports complex analytics and seamless mobile integration. With features like geo-spatial mapping and easy dossier creation, it's compatible with Teradata, offering robust metadata management and customizations through its SDK.
MicroStrategy provides enterprise-class business intelligence with streamlined data governance and efficiently handles diverse data sources. Its platform offers ad-hoc reporting, self-service features, and interactive visualizations. The active user community and customization options ensure adaptability, while enhancements are needed in data modeling and visual capabilities. The administration tools, schema creation, and dashboard development can be complex, and licensing costs are significant. Improvements in cloud integration, multi-device support, community support, and training are necessary for wider adoption.
What are the features of MicroStrategy?MicroStrategy is implemented for reporting and analytics in industries like finance and operations. Corporations utilize it for creating dashboards, financial reporting, and operational data analysis. It's effective for management reporting, tracking sales, inventory, and providing real-time insights. Integrations with CRM applications enhance its utility in producing interactive digital formats, replacing traditional reporting methods.
